Can you walk on the Golden Gate Bridge at night?

Sidewalk access hours during Daylight Savings Time: 5:00 AM to 9:00 PM. Sidewalk access hours during Standard Time (when it's NOT Daylight Savings Time: 5:00 AM to 6:30 PM.

Total length of Bridge including approaches from abutment to abutment is 1.7 miles (8,981 ft or 2,737 m). Total length of Bridge including approaches from abutment to abutment, plus the distance to the Toll Plaza, is 9,150 ft (2,788 m).

Drivers crossing the bridge only have to pay for tolls if they are driving across the bridge southbound or when entering San Francisco City. If you will be crossing the bridge to head to Marin County (northbound), you will not be charged for tolls.

Only motorized vehicles pay tolls on the Golden Gate Bridge. Pedestrians and bikes cross for free, but (logically) must use the sidewalks.

5 Fun Facts About the Golden Gate Bridge
  • The bridge is actually not golden at all! It's a bright red-orange.
  • It was named one of the Seven Wonders of the Modern World.
  • It took four years to build.
  • There are approximately 600,000 rivets in each of the bridge's towers.
  • It's the most photographed bridge in the world.
